Photograph, Archival Pigment Print Size US: 36 x 53 in Size EU: 92 x 135 cm A native of Tacoma, Washington, Tim Klein is a photographer based in Chicago, Illinois. The foundation of Klein’s artistic practice is rooted in journalism photography. His career spans almost twenty years. Klein exhibits in Chicago’s River North Gallery District and he has been published internationally and nationally in newspapers and magazines such as New York Times, The New Yorker, Esquire, The Wall Street Journal, Smithsonian Magazine, Time Out, Variety Magazine, Out Magazine, Wired Japan, W Magazine, Reader’s Digest, National Geographic, and Forbes, among others. Klein’s photography is located in the collections of DeGroot Fine Art Acquistions, The Draper, Flats Studios, Chicago Department of Transportation, The Otis, Terrell Place, Presence Health Chicago, and The Ardus, among others. Klein approaches contemporary photography with an awareness of the power the photograph possesses in documenting an ever-changing world. Preserving the sublime qualities of nature, the humbling scale of forests and mountains for generations to come. Series: PURPLE All available sizes and editions: 40" x 40" editions of 18 50" x 50" editions of 7 60" x 60" editions of 3 72" x 72" editions of 1 Archival Pigment Print on Fine Art Baryta paper Mounted and Framed Guido Argentini is an Italian photographer, known for his highly stylized and erotic images of the body, both male and female. In Argentini's striking photography, people are turned into living shiny sculptures, made of silver and gold, a daring and innovative study of the human body and its range of movement. Color and texture radically influence how we perceive shapes. While looking for an innovative approach at a 1995 Miami photo shoot, photographic master Guido Argentini was moved to coat a model in silver makeup. The result was as beautiful as it was intriguing--the subtle greyish tones highlighted angles and surfaces in a way that was other-worldly. Inspired by the results, Argentini created a whole series of silver-hued models. In so doing, he uncovered a fresh perspective for nude photography. Evoking the luminous polished planes of Brancusi and the verve of Degas' ballet sketches, these photographs endow the human body with both the solidity of sculpture and the vivid energy of dance. Using geometrical props Guido Argentini created a contrast between the human body and the archetypal forms of geometry: triangles, circles, and squares. “I always felt that photography was too close to reality. Painting and sculpting allow you to be more abstract when working with the human figure. My love for dance and for sculpture inspired this series of photographs. The watercolors of Rodin, sketches of dancers in very erotic and dynamic positions and the polished abstract bronzes of Brancusi were my strongest source of inspiration. In the pictures of ARGENTUM, the skin, covered with silver paint, becomes an even, shiny surface and the human figure becomes more abstract. To each image I gave a title, the name of a god or a goddess from different cults and religions, Greek, Egyptian, Celtic and many more. ARGENTUM is, once again, a tribute to women. The monotheistic religions took away the important role and all the power that women had in the antique cults. Goddesses, symbols of women, the creators of Life, have been banished completely from any current monotheistic religion. Giving to the women in my photographs these forgotten names of goddesses I’m giving a tribute to their beauty as well as to their spirituality. In this historical moment we are beginning to feel that is time to restore the values of THE SACRED FEMININE. The world has been controlled by male values for a long time. This has brought violence, war and the cult of materialism to humanity.
